GithubHelp home page GithubHelp logo

akashtailor-exe / 30-days-of-verilog Goto Github PK

View Code? Open in Web Editor NEW
22.0 1.0 1.0 84 KB

30 Days of Verilog: Dive into digital circuits with a month of Verilog coding challenges. From logic gates to FSMs, sharpen your skills and simulate your designs. Let's code and conquer circuits!

30-days-of-code 30daysofcode digital-logic-design digitalcircuit verilog verilog-project vlsi rtl-coding rtl-design verilog-programs

30-days-of-verilog's Introduction

30 Days of Verilog

Repo was not updated daily. I posted consistently on Linkedin

Embark on a journey through 30 days of Verilog exploration! ๐ŸŒŸ

Welcome to my personal project: 30 Days of Verilog. Over the next 30 days, I'll be taking a deep dive into the world of digital circuits and Verilog programming. My goal is to create and showcase 30 different digital circuits, each implemented using Verilog HDL.

About the Project

The aim of this project is to:

  • Learn Verilog: Gain a solid understanding of Verilog and its applications.
  • Explore Digital Circuits: Create a variety of digital circuits to explore different concepts.
  • Document Progress: Document my journey, challenges, and solutions for each circuit.
  • Share with the Community: Provide a resource for others interested in Verilog and digital design.

Repository Structure

Each day, I will add a new folder from Day 1 to Day 30, containing:

  • Verilog Code: Implementation of the day's digital circuit in Verilog.
  • README: Explanation of the circuit, its purpose, and my approach.
  • Simulation: Simulation results, waveforms, and test benches (if applicable).
  • Reflections: Insights and lessons learned during the implementation.

Feel free to follow along, offer suggestions, or learn from my progress!

Table of Contents

Let's Connect

I'd love to share my journey with you and connect with fellow Verilog enthusiasts:

Stay Tuned

Join me as I explore the world of Verilog programming and digital circuits over the next 30 days. Let's explore, create, and learn together!

Happy Verilog coding! ๐Ÿ’ป

30-days-of-verilog's People

Contributors

akashtailor-exe avatar

Stargazers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

Watchers

 avatar

Forkers

aaronyap2002

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.